What Does “Water-Positive” Really Mean?

A water-positive building doesn’t just conserve water — it creates it.

Through on-site generation, treatment, reuse, and redistribution, water-positive architecture ensures that each building contributes to, rather than drains from, the local water cycle.

AWGs make this possible by:

 Generating clean water on demand from ambient humidity.

Reducing demand on municipal and groundwater systems.

 Supporting reuse loops for greywater, cooling, and landscaping.

 Integrating with smart building management systems (BMS) for real-time monitoring and efficiency tracking.

In essence, every litre produced brings a building one step closer to regenerative self-reliance.

 

How AWGs Fit Into Regenerative Building Design

AWGs complement other green technologies to form a closed-loop water cycle within modern buildings.

Here’s how they integrate:

With Rainwater Harvesting Systems

AWGs supplement inconsistent rainfall, ensuring year-round supply in dry or arid zones.

With Greywater Recycling

Generated water can be reused for non-potable applications, creating a balanced water economy inside the building.

With Renewable Energy Systems

Solar-powered AWGs reduce the energy footprint, delivering sustainable hydration even off-grid.

With Smart Monitoring Dashboards

Facility managers can track water production, consumption, and reuse — supporting WELL, NABERS, and Green Star reporting.

Together, these systems make buildings not just sustainable — but regenerative.
